Matthew Quaid is a writer/director born and raised in the bay area of California. He is best known for online comedy sketches and short films that tell unique stories. He graduated from San Francisco State University with a degree in Cinema.
I never thought I could or would make a horror film. But 2020 has been year of so much anxiety that it lead to the worst sleep of my life. I absolutely dreaded every night trying to find ways to go to sleep and stay asleep. I tried dozens of remedies, but I would always end up waking up almost every two hours having to be alone in the dark with my depressing thoughts. These unhealthy nights lead to unhealthy days. At some point I finally had the energy to make a film that I hope displays the dread of night.
